17ML-2 SAVAGE MDL 99 #416463Savage Model 99 lever action rifle, .250-3000 Savage caliber, Serial #416463. The rifle is in fine overall condition with a 24” barrel with a ramped blade front and adjustable rear sights. The barrel retainsthe majority of its blue finish with some losses at the muzzle. The receiver also retains a significant amount of its original blue with light surface erosion, high point edge wear and the brass round counter intact. The lever is beautifully case hardened. The checkered wood stock is in very good condition with small mars, compressions and a social security number etched behind the pistol grip. The butt ends with a Savagemarked textured steel butt plate. The bore is fair and may clean, the action crisp and markings are sharp on this desirable Model 99 manufactured in approximately 1946.
